Abstract

The reaction of 2,6-pyridinedicarbaldehyde with 2,6-bis[(2-aminoethyl)thiomethyl)]pyridine in the presence of Pb(O2CMe)2 yields the mononuclear lead(II) complex of a [1 + 1] 18-membered, potentially hexadentate, N4S2 imine macrocycle, the crystal and molecular structure of which has been determined [space group Pc, a= 8.358(3), b= 15.158(5), c= 10.127(4)A, β= 99.87(3)°]. This structure represents a rare example of a structurally characterised lead(II) complex with a macrocyclic ligand containing both nitrogen and sulfur donor atoms.
